1.Dean Ambrose turns on Seth Rollins

Dean Ambrose and Seth Rollins.

This past Monday on Raw, Dean Ambrose returned to a thunderous ovation to assist his brethren, Seth Rollins. Ambrose will be at Rollins' corner as Rollins fights Dolph Ziggler (with Drew McIntyre in his corner) for the Intercontinental Championship.

A heel turn for Ambrose has been heavily rumored, even before he went down with an elbow injury. Ambrose is still expected to turn on Rollins in the near future out of jealousy and envy of all that Rollins accomplished in Ambrose's absence.

WWE could very well pull the trigger on Ambrose's heel turn as soon as this sunday at SummerSlam.

2. The Rock returns to confront Elias

This one is inevitable in the event that The Rock is available for SummerSlam. Elias was in the midst of a rivalry with Bobby Lashley but a match wasn't announced between the two for SummerSlam which was contrary to expectations. In stead, WWE announced that Elias will be performing his greatest song at SummerSlam on the main show. This means that WWE has other plans in store for Elias which don't necessarily involve Lashley.

Given that Elias insulted The Rock in his hometown a few week ago and that The Rock has teased a potential return to the ring, it's extremely plausible that the two stars will have a confrontation in the near future.

Although, WWE might just have Lashley ruin yet another Elias segment. It's likely that the Rock may make a one-off appearance to shut down Elias.
